Read the quotation. Let me walk three weeks in the footsteps of my enemy, carry the same burden, have the same trials as he, before I say one word to criticize. Which statement best restates the main idea of this quotation?

Do not criticize an enemy after pretending to be him or her for three weeks.It’s not good to criticize others because we don’t know what they face in life.It’s acceptable to criticize an enemy because he or she is not a good person.Criticizing another person is all right after a certain amount of time has passed.

The statement which best restates the main idea of the quotation is the following one:

It’s not good to criticize others because we don’t know what they face in life.

People generally criticize everybody, especially someone they do not like for some reason. However, doing so is wrong, since we don't know why a person behaves in this or in that way. As Nietzsche said, one cannot be blamed for being who he or she is; every single individual is the result of a series of circumstances. It does not mean we are allowed to do whatever we feel like without measuring the effect it might have on others; it simply tells us that whoever we criticize, for whatever reasons, does certain things and acts in certain ways due to the large number of circumstances which that specific individual had to experience throughout life.
